The Canada hospital acquired infection control market is experiencing growth driven by increasing awareness about the importance of infection prevention in healthcare settings. Factors such as the rising incidence of hospital-acquired infections, stringent regulations, and the need for effective control measures are propelling market growth. Key players in the market are developing innovative infection control solutions, including advanced disinfection technologies, antimicrobial coatings, and surveillance systems to enhance patient safety and reduce healthcare-associated infections. Hospitals and healthcare facilities are investing in infection control products and services to minimize the risk of transmission and improve overall patient outcomes. The market is characterized by a competitive landscape with companies focusing on research and development to introduce new and improved infection control solutions to meet the evolving needs of healthcare providers.

In the Canada hospital acquired infection control market, challenges include increasing antibiotic resistance leading to more difficult-to-treat infections, limited resources and funding for implementing comprehensive infection control measures, staff shortages impacting the ability to maintain strict hygiene protocols, and the need for continuous training and education to ensure compliance with best practices. Additionally, the variability in infection control practices across different healthcare facilities poses a challenge in maintaining consistent standards of care. Addressing these challenges requires a multi-faceted approach involving collaboration between healthcare providers, policymakers, and industry stakeholders to implement effective strategies for preventing and managing hospital-acquired infections.

In Canada, the government has implemented various policies and initiatives aimed at controlling hospital-acquired infections (HAIs) to ensure patient safety and reduce healthcare costs. The Public Health Agency of Canada has developed guidelines for infection prevention and control in healthcare settings, emphasizing the importance of hand hygiene, environmental cleaning, and proper use of personal protective equipment. Additionally, the Canadian Patient Safety Institute works to improve patient safety and reduce HAIs through initiatives such as the Hand Hygiene Campaign and the National Patient Safety Consortium. Provincial health authorities also play a crucial role in monitoring and regulating infection control practices in hospitals to prevent and manage HAIs effectively. Overall, these government policies emphasize the importance of implementing evidence-based practices to prevent HAIs and enhance patient outcomes in Canadian healthcare facilities.
